ENVy compares the environment of two computers (pc) and provides a color-annotated display of the results. ENVy compares Environment Variables, over 400 Internet Explorer® settings, Network Configuration, Installed Software, Operating System, Processor, Startup Commands, Process List and more.

 

ENVy was written for the times when you've asked "Why does it work on your computer? What's different about your environment?" Well, ENVy helps you find out and is a must for troubleshooting.

 

ENVy is essential for any developer or IT professional that works with multiple computers. Using ENVy v1.2 will save you time, money, and headache by instantly identifying and guiding you right to the differences between your environments.

·         Quickly compare Environment Variables, over 400 Internet Explorer® Settings, Network Configuration, Installed Software, Operating System, Processor, Startup Commands, and Process List of two computers.

·         Color-annotated, single column display allows the user to quickly locate and identify differences.

·         Differences are displayed adjacent to the differenced item which makes visual comparison clear and comprehensive.

·         Merge environment variable differences with a single right-click. Export all or a subset of variables for easy import onto other machines.

·         Full capability for the creation, editing, deletion, and renaming of Environment Variables and values using a user-friendly, vertical display of values.

ENVy is a stunningly useful program for anyone who has to code, debug, or install software across multiple machines. It provides a detailed breakdown and comparison of all environment and system variables, allowing you to very quickly locate differences between configurations, differences which might cause all manner of unexpected bugs. (I once had a system crash due to the installation of invalid fonts. Go figure.)

"But it works on my machine!" is the plaintive cry of the Great North American Programmer, trying hard to understand why customers are calling in with complaints. You can give ENVy v1.1, which is 100% freeware, to clients or co-workers so that their configurations can be compared with your own. This is much, much, faster than trying to get customers to look up this information on their own systems, or get a remote IT department to do it for you.

The interface is very simple. A set of tabs divides the data into categories, and each category is displayed via a clean tree view. One side, the "This PC" side, shows all possible data values, with colors highlighting differences. At first, it is confusing that only one side is colored, but ultimately, this serves ENVy's purpose better--you can instantly see which values are different or missing between systems.

ENVy is mostly of use to developers or network administrators who need to compare machines. However, it can also be a useful tool if you ever need to send your settings to a third party to aid in their troubleshooting of a problem on your system.
